In my area PPO and HMO were non existent. Then they began to appear and recruit physicians to their panels. I still to this day remember the shock and consternation when a patient first requested a transfer of medical records to another physician because I was "not on their insurance". It took me a while to come to terms with the implications of this seismic shift in doctor-patient relationships which is of course completely unknown to the younger generation of physicians. I can tell you that I never looked at the relationship with my patients in the same light ever since. No longer was there a bond of sacred trust and faith but rather an economical business model. They "use" a doctor because he is "on their plan". I no longer give it a moment's thought when someone's insurance changes at the beginning of a new plan year and they switch to another "PCP". New names and faces and medical histories will soon come along to replace them and keep me busy as long as I care to keep working. Sad state of affairs created by someone's brilliant idea of "third party" payors. I for one was much happier when there were only two parties.
